Documentation Index
Fetch the complete documentation index at: https://docs.nudgen.net/llms.txt
Use this file to discover all available pages before exploring further.
Ikhtisar
Nudgen CLI dirancang dengan pendekatan AI-First. Meskipun menyediakan TUI yang indah untuk manusia, setiap perintah juga dioptimalkan untuk komunikasi antar mesin.Pola Agentic
Saat agen AI (seperti Claude, GPT, atau agen otomatisasi khusus) menggunakan CLI, ia harus mengikuti pola-pola berikut:- Output JSON: Tambahkan
--jsonke setiap perintah untuk mendapatkan data yang dapat diurai mesin. - Sadar Konteks: Selalu verifikasi konteks tim sebelum melakukan operasi.
- Non-Interaktif: Gunakan flag untuk melewati perintah TUI interaktif.
Otomatisasi JSON
Setiap perintah daftar dan status mendukung flag--json. Ini mengembalikan struktur JSON yang bersih, bukan tabel yang diformat.
Alur Kerja Multi-tenant untuk Agen
Karena Nudgen mendukung banyak tim, agen harus memastikan bahwa ia beroperasi pada tim yang benar sebelum membuat atau memperbarui sumber daya. Alur Kerja yang Direkomendasikan:- Periksa Tim Saat Ini:
- Ganti Tim (jika perlu):
Jika
iddari langkah sebelumnya tidak cocok dengan tim target, ganti: - Jalankan Perintah Data:
Lanjutkan dengan perintah
campaigns,contacts, ataubrand.
Praktik Terbaik untuk Pengembang Agen
- Penanganan Kesalahan: Pantau kode keluar (exit code) perintah CLI. Kode keluar non-nol menunjukkan adanya kesalahan (validasi, jaringan, atau autentikasi).
- Pembatasan Laju (Rate Limiting): CLI berkomunikasi dengan API Nudgen. Pastikan skrip agen Anda menangani potensi pembatasan laju dengan anggun.
- Mode Senyap: Jika perintah tidak mendukung flag tertentu untuk setiap prompt, pastikan agen Anda dapat menangani stream stdout/stderr tanpa terjebak dalam loop TUI.